Regional differences can have odd effects on diseases, it's not fully understood why though. For example MS rates seem to correlate with how close you are to the equator, with being closer to the poles increasing your chances of developing it. Furthermore moving from the equator to a more polar climate greatly increases the risk, while moving from the poles to the equator actually decreases it.
